The keywords are trending because they relate to a significant and recently played American football game between two prominent NFL teams, the New England Patriots and the Buffalo Bills. This matchup is a long-standing divisional rivalry within the AFC East, guaranteeing high stakes and passionate fan interest.

Here's a breakdown of the key reasons:

  • Recent Marquee Matchup: The New England Patriots recently defeated the Buffalo Bills 23-20 in a Week 5 "Sunday Night Football" game on October 5, 2025. This was a highly anticipated game, as the Bills were one of the last undefeated teams in the NFL before the loss.
  • Intense Divisional Rivalry: Both the Patriots and Bills are in the AFC East division, meaning they play each other twice every season. This creates a fierce rivalry rooted in historical clashes and the constant battle for division supremacy.
  • Key Player Performances and Storylines:
    • Drake Maye (Patriots Quarterback): Maye, a second-year quarterback, led the Patriots to a crucial upset victory, making key throws and demonstrating significant growth in his first primetime start. His performance, including setting up the game-winning field goal, is a major talking point. He was also named to the 2025 NFL Pro Bowl Games, replacing Josh Allen due to injury, highlighting his impressive debut season.
    • Josh Allen (Bills Quarterback): Allen, a star quarterback for the Bills, had an uncharacteristically sloppy game with three turnovers, which he openly criticized as "piss-poor offense." His performance and frustration are significant discussion points following the loss. Allen was also on the verge of breaking an NFL record for most games with at least one passing and rushing touchdown before this game.
    • Stefon Diggs (Patriots Wide Receiver): The game marked Diggs' return to Buffalo after being traded from the Bills to the Patriots in April 2024. He had a standout game against his former team with 10 catches for 146 yards.
    • James Cook (Bills Running Back): Cook's streak of eight games with a rushing touchdown was snapped, and he was held under 100 scrimmage yards for the first time this season by the Patriots' defense.
    • Andy Borregales (Patriots Kicker): As a rookie, Borregales successfully kicked the game-winning 52-yard field goal with only 15 seconds left, securing the upset for the Patriots.
  • Impact on Standings and Playoff Race: The Patriots' victory tightened the AFC East race, bringing them within one game of the Bills. Games between divisional rivals often have significant implications for playoff seeding.
